Headcount Request & Position Justification Survey

Captures the business case behind a request to open or backfill a role — driver, urgency, cost, alternatives considered, and success metrics — for HR and Finance to evaluate headcount requests consistently. An AI follow-up interview stress-tests the requester's reasoning on why now, why this level, and what happens if the request is delayed or denied.

What type of request is this?

  • New headcount (net new role)
  • Backfill for someone who left
  • Reclassification or upgrade of an existing role
  • Conversion of a contractor/temp to permanent

What is the primary driver for this position right now?

  • Business growth / increased demand
  • Employee attrition
  • New project or strategic initiative
  • Workload relief / preventing burnout
  • Compliance or regulatory requirement
  • Closing a skills or capability gap

For each alternative to hiring, indicate whether it has been tried or considered.

5 rows × 4 columns
  • Redistribute work among current team
  • Automate or use tools/software
  • Contractor or temporary staffing
  • Overtime or temporary reassignment
  • Delay until next planning cycle
Columns: Already tried, not enough · Feasible short-term only · Not feasible · Not considered

Probe the business case behind this request in depth: why this position is needed now rather than later, why it must be at this seniority/level rather than a lower-cost option, and what concretely breaks (missed revenue, compliance risk, attrition, delayed launches) if the request is denied or delayed six months. If the requester leaned on an alternative like automation or redistribution, press on why that alternative was ruled out and what evidence supports it. If confidence in the role vs. alternatives was low, dig into what would need to be true to raise it.
